AFCON UNDER-20 AFCON: BURKINA FASO SET TO SEIZE GROUP B LEADERSHIP FROM CAR

Central African Republic (CAR) welcome Burkina Faso today at the Under-20 Africa Cup of Nations finals in Mauritania.

Burkina Faso will certainly be looking forward toppling the Group B leaders from the summit at the tournament.

The Junior Stallions’ coach Oscar Barro has since urged his charges to go for maximum points in this clash.

Burkina Faso started the group’s matches with a goalless draw against Tunisia on Monday afternoon.

On the other hand, CAR also shared the spoils with Namibia to go top of the group on goal-aggregate.

Before the tournament, the West Africans played friendlies against Gambia and Cameroon.

Burkina Faso lost 2-1 to Gambia on February 9 five days after playing out to a goalless draw against Cameroon.

 

In the opening matches, Cameroon made a winning start when beating the hosts Mauritania 1-0 at the Olympic Stadium in Nouakchott on Sunday night.

In another game for Group A, Mozambique lost 2-0 to Uganda on Monday.

The tournament will run from February 14 to March 6 2021.
